What Is ACES and PIES data? ACES and PIES are standardized data formats, exclusive to the automotive industry. ACES (Aftermarket Catalog Exchange Standard) supports automotive application (fitment) data. PIES (Product Information Exchange Standard) supports product (part number) data.
